[Elecraft] KPA500 keyed with no drive

2019-04-05 Thread Andy Durbin
An unexpected shut down of my station PC led to a cascading failure that caused 
my Arduino station logger to key my KPA500.I was alerted to the problem by 
the KPA500 fan running a level 1.  Indicated temperature was 50 deg C.   I 
estimate that my KPA500 was continuously keyed with no RF drive for about 2 
hours.

My system design error was corrected by adding a blocking diode between my 
Arduino station logger and the KAT500 key line so it won't happen again. 
(Arduino monitors the state of the key line but pulled it low when it lost 
power from the USB hub).

My question - Is there any possibility that my KPA500 suffered any harm from 
being keyed for such a long time with no drive?

Re: [Elecraft] FLDIGI with K3s

2019-04-05 Thread Don Wilhelm

Ray and all,

The K3/K3S/KX3/KX2 has a DATA submode AFSK A which is LSB (unless you 
change it) and also has special filters for RTTY - you have to set the 
mark frequency in the menu to match your software (or the other way 
around).
Using the DATA submodes rather than SSB automatically sets the 
compression to zero and the TX and RX EQ to flat.  That allows you to 
switch to DATA modes without disturbing whatever compression and EQ 
settings you have set for SSB.


Read the Elecraft manuals for more information.

So if you set the K3 to AFSK A, you are placing the K3 in USB mode and 
complying with the FLDIGI instructions that you read.


FLDIGI instructions do not consider the features available on the K3 
because they are written for the lowest common denominator and apply to 
transceivers that do not have specific DATA modes.


As a side note, for non-RTTY soundcard data modes, use K3 DATA submode 
DATA A rather than SSB USB.

[Elecraft] New release of Win4K3Suite, Version 2.002

2019-04-05 Thread Tom
Hello,
There is a new version of Win4K3Suite available, version 2.002.  For those
of you who know the software, going to version 2 doesn't necessarily mean
major changes since the software has been around for 6+ years and has had
dozens of enhancements. This version though is worthy of the version 2
designation. 
Win4K3Suite now has user customizable Skins, that can change the look and
feel of Win4K3.  Be sure to check out the pre-defined skins or create your
own.  Here is an example:
https://va2fsq.com/wp-content/uploads/Win4K3-Version-2.png

This version also now requires .NET 4.6 or higher.  This will be
automatically installed by Windows if it does not exist.  If you computer
asks to be rebooted, accept and then when it restarted, run the installation
of Win4K3 again.  That will bring it up to date.  Be sure to follow the
detailed instructions on the download page.
Win4K3Suite is a full featured control program for the K3/S, KX3 and KX2.
It has a built in Panadapter that works with LPPAN and a sound card, as well
as the SDRPlay RSP's. It supports the KAT500, KPA500/1500 and the KXPA100 on
most of the above radios.  A unique feature is that is has 6 built in
Virtual Radios, each of which works just like an Elecraft radio.  This
allows sharing of a single COM port with up to 6 applications.  It also has
a built in HRDLogbook server and the EiBi Shortwave database which is now up
to date.
